Shell is a multinational energy company that is well-known for its distinctive red and yellow logo, known as the Shell Logotype. The logo has become one of the most recognizable symbols in the world and has been used by the company for over a hundred years. The Shell Logotype was first introduced in 1904 and has undergone several changes over the years. The original logo featured a stylized version of a scallop shell, which is where the company’s name is derived from. The Shell Logotype has been used on a wide range of products and marketing materials, including fuel pumps, oil cans, and advertising campaigns. The logo has become a symbol of quality and trust for consumers, who associate it with a company that is reliable, reputable, and environmentally conscious.
One of the key reasons for the success of the Shell Logotype is its consistency and longevity. The logo has remained largely unchanged for over a century, which has helped to build brand recognition and loyalty among consumers.
